Recently there has been a number of requests in this and in other newsgroups on the performance of different SCSI drives. The list below was compiled after running a raw read benchmark called 'disktest' on different systems. The raw read transfer rates always reflect raw read() calls with big block sizes, i.e. far beyond 8K. However, the relative performance between the different systems seem to be more or less the same when doing 8K transfers, although the individual transfer rates are lower. Bare in mind that this test resembles a one-user/one-process environment, and that the read() operations bypasses the file system buffer cache. The purpose of the test is to exercise the drive and the operation of the disk subsystem, not the implementation of the file system nor the performance of the host cpu. The results are more or less what could be expected and also in most cases close to what the drive vendors use in their brochures etc. For the HP drive this is not true -- HP claims that the drive should do synchronous transfers at the same rate as for instance the Elite drive. Any experiences with the HP drive confirming or not confirming this result will be welcome. The benchmark was written by Craig Leres at Lawerence Berkeley Laboratory, and can be ftp-ed from a number of places around the net (ifi.uio.no for instance). In the list below, some none SCSI disk subsystems are included for reference. -------------------- DISKTEST BENCHMARK ---------------------- Raw read rate Disk subsystem ------------------------------------------------------------ 2800.46 KB/sec Ciprico RAID-3 array, DS5000/200 2631.97 KB/sec SUN dual head IPI, SUN 4/490 2541.38 KB/sec Ciprico RAID-3 array, SUN 4/260 2448.86 KB/sec Seagate Elite, DS5000/200 2342.02 KB/sec Fujitsu M2382 ESMD, SUN 3/480 2290.18 KB/sec Fujitsu M2382 ESMD, SUN 3/280 2282.71 KB/sec Fujitsu M2392 ESMD, SUN 3/280 2222.83 KB/sec Fujitsu M2392 ESMD, Solbourne 5/801 2153.96 KB/sec Fujitsu M226S SCSI, DS5000/200 2099.24 KB/sec Seagate WREN VII, DS5000/200 2026.99 KB/sec DEC RZ57, DS5000/200 2008.00 KB/sec Seagate Elite, Sparcstation 1+ 1684.85 KB/sec Seagate WREN Runner, Dolphin Triton-88 1217.46 KB/sec Fujitsu M2344, Sun 4/260 1200.25 KB/sec HP 97549T/P, DS5000/200 1116.03 KB/sec DEC RA90, Vaxserver 3600 1101.45 KB/sec DEC RZ56, DS5000/200 1090.29 KB/sec DEC RA82, Vaxserver 3600 1036.29 KB/sec DEC RZ55, DS5000/200 971.56 KB/sec DEC RF71, DS5400 904.24 KB/sec Unknown SCSI drive, AViiON 300 +==================================================================+ ! ! !
